油水分配系数/LogP:

LogP值指的是某物质在正辛醇/水两相体系中的分配系数的对数值,反映了物质在油水两相中的分配情况。其中、LogP值越大,说明该物质越亲油;反之,LogP值越小,则说明该物质越亲水。

生产制备方法及用途展开↓

制备方法


适应症:用于敏感菌所引起的呼吸系统、肝胆系统、五官、尿路感染及心内膜炎、败血症。
